Physiological Characteristics of Hybrid‘Pink blue’from Lycoris longituba and L. haywardii

摘要: 为研究以长筒石蒜为母本和红蓝石蒜为父本的杂交后代‘粉蓝石蒜’杂种优势,利用LI-6400 便携式光合分析仪测定了‘粉蓝石蒜’的光合参数,并对其生物碱的含量进行分析。结果表明:‘粉蓝石蒜’的净光合效率、气孔导度、胞间CO2浓度、蒸腾速率、叶绿素a 和b 含量及光合色素总量介于其2 个亲本之间;水分利用效率高于亲本;石蒜碱含量高于亲本,加兰他敏含量比亲本低。‘粉蓝石蒜’在抗旱性和药用活性成分(石蒜碱)含量方面表现出了杂种的优势。

Abstract: To study the heterosis of‘Pink blue’, takingLycoris haywardii as female parent andL. longituba as male parent, the photosynthetic parameters of‘Pink blue’were detected with LI-6400 Portable Photosynthetic Analyzer, and the alkaloid contents were analyzed. The results showed that the net photosynthetic efficiency (Pn ), stomatal conductance (Gs ), intercellular CO2 concentration (Ci ), transpiration rate (Tr ), and the content of chlorophyll a and b and the total of chlorophyll of‘Pink blue’were between those of female parent and male parent. The water use efficiency (WUE ) of‘Pink blue’was better than that of its parents. The lycorine content of‘Pink blue’was higher than that of parents while the galanthamine content was lower. In conclusion,‘Pink blue’shows the heterosis on drought resistance and active medicinal ingredients (e.g. lycorin).
